The Oxford Handbook of Aquinas (Oxford University Press, 2012) Davies also edits the
Outstanding Christian Thinkers series (Continuum: London and New York, 1989–2004), having overseen the publication of twenty-eight volumes, and of the
Great Medieval Thinkers, published by Oxford University Press. He was Book Reviews Editor for
New Blackfriars (1979–95) and a member of the editorial board for
Religious Studies (2000–6). He is now Associate European Editor (since 1992) for the
International Philosophical Quarterly. As literary executor for the late
Herbert McCabe (died 2001), Davies edited and published five volumes of work that McCabe left at the time of his death:
God Still Matters (Continuum: London and New York, 2002);
God, Christ and Us (Continuum: London and New York, 2003);
The Good Life: Ethics and the Pursuit of Happiness (Continuum: London and New York, 2005);
Faith Within Reason (Continuum: London and New York, 2007); and
On Aquinas (Continuum: London and New York, 2008). == Bibliography ==
